Heartfelt reminiscences and humorous anecdotes abounded as NCSY celebrated the twentieth anniversary of the Ben Zakkai Honor Society’s NCSY National Scholarship Reception. Held at the Museum of Jewish Heritage in downtown Manhattan on February 8, two hundred guests joined in the meaningful evening as four former NCSY participants were welcomed into the prestigious honor society
